What Is Aged AR in Dental Practices?

Aged AR in dental practices is accounts receivable that has remained uncollected beyond a defined threshold typically 60, 90, or 120 days from the date of service or initial claim submission. Accounts in the 90+ day bucket are the primary measure of AR health because the probability of collection falls sharply once claims reach that age.

Most dental practice management platforms and billing benchmarks track AR aging in four buckets: 0-30 days (current), 31-60 days (early warning), 61-90 days (action required), and 90+ days (critical). Best-run dental practices keep AR over 90 days below 5% of total AR. Practices where this bucket exceeds 22% of total AR experience write-off rates three to four times higher than their peers.

Aged AR has two components in dental: insurance AR (unpaid insurance claims) and patient AR (patient-responsible balances after insurance). Each ages differently and requires a distinct recovery approach.

  • Insurance AR ages primarily because of denied claims that were not resubmitted promptly, missing documentation, or payer-specific errors in the original submission. These claims have a strict timely-filing window most payers set this at 90-365 days from date of service after which re-submission is no longer possible regardless of the merit of the claim.
  • Patient AR ages because collection at point of service was not completed, follow-up was inconsistent or delayed, or billing statements were sent by mail with no automated escalation to phone or SMS outreach.

The Manual Collections Process: What It Actually Takes

Running manual dental AR collections means assigning a billing specialist or more often, a front desk coordinator doing double duty to work through an AR aging report on a schedule. In practice, this is what that workflow looks like:

  1. Pull an AR aging report from the practice management system
  2. Sort by age (90+ days first) and by dollar value (highest balances first)
  3. For insurance AR: identify denial reason from the EOB or payer portal, gather any missing documentation, correct coding errors, and resubmit all done claim by claim
  4. For patient AR: generate and mail a paper statement, then call the patient if no payment arrives within 10–14 days a cycle that can repeat two to three times before escalation to a collection agency
  5. Update the practice management system with each follow-up action so the audit trail is maintained
  6. Track timely-filing deadlines manually, because a claim resubmitted after the payer's window closes cannot be recovered regardless of its validity

This process is not flawed in concept. But it has structural limitations that matter when AR aging is the problem:

Coverage gaps. Insurance AR denial notices arrive seven days a week, including after hours. Manual workflows only cover business hours and if Friday's denials are not caught until Monday, a claim has already lost two days of its appeal window.

Prioritization accuracy. Manual aging report review tends to focus on recent, large-dollar claims. Smaller claims from 90-120 days ago the ones approaching write-off territory often sit at the bottom of the list and never get worked.

Scalability ceiling. A single dental billing specialist at $63,529/year can typically manage a set number of accounts before productivity drops. As a group adds locations, the headcount required scales linearly and so do the salary costs.

Clean claim rate. The industry average for manual billing is 80-85% clean claims on first submission. That means 15-20% of claims require at least one round of correction and resubmission each round, adding days to the collection timeline and increasing the probability that the account ages into a higher-risk bucket.

Cost Comparison: AI vs Manual Collections Staffing

The direct cost of manual dental AR collections is straightforward. A dental billing specialist earns a median salary of $63,529/year, ranging from $49,544 to $75,356 depending on experience and market. Add payroll taxes, health benefits (typically 1.25–1.4x salary fully loaded), and onboarding costs. A single billing FTE runs $75,000–$100,000/year in total compensation.

That cost is per location. A DSO with five locations and separate billing coverage at each site commits $375,000–$500,000/year in billing staff costs alone. That is before turnover, productivity loss during absences, or revenue lost from claims that go unworked during peak periods.

The hidden costs of manual billing go further:

  • Denied claim resubmission cost. Each manually resubmitted claim requires staff time to identify the denial reason, gather documentation, correct the claim, and resubmit. Industry estimates put the administrative cost of a denied claim at $25–$50 per resubmission. The 15–20% first-pass denial rate in manual billing means a busy practice absorbs this cost on hundreds of claims per month.
  • Revenue leakage from uncollected patient balances. Practices that rely on mailed statements and manual call campaigns collect a fraction of what automated, multi-touch outreach recovers. The average dental practice loses 6–12% of collectible revenue before a bill is even sent.
  • Write-offs. Moving collection ratio from 94% to 98% adds $60,000/year to a $1.5M practice. A 2% collection rate gap is exactly the kind of chronic leakage that manual follow-up leaves unaddressed in high-volume periods.

When Manual Collections Can Work

There are scenarios where manual dental AR collections are adequate and being clear about them is useful for the decision.

Very small practices with predictable, low claim volume. A solo practitioner billing under $500K/year with an experienced billing specialist and a narrow payer mix can maintain a clean AR ledger manually. When claim volume is low enough, every account gets individual attention on a consistent schedule. In those conditions, the gaps that drive AR aging in larger practices do not emerge.

Practices with a seasoned in-house billing team and established payer relationships. An experienced dental billing specialist who has worked with the same three carriers for eight years knows the documentation requirements, appeal procedures, and escalation contacts for those payers. That institutional knowledge applied consistently and proactively can keep AR days in the 25–35 range without AI.

The challenge: this knowledge lives in one person. Turnover resets the clock entirely. Solo practices looking to formalize their dental revenue cycle management workflows gain the most from doing so before AR90+ crosses the 5% threshold.

What is a healthy AR days benchmark for dental practices?

Verimedix recommends targeting a 14-21 day insurance AR turnaround, a 98%+ collection ratio, and keeping less than 15% of AR over 60 days old. Practices falling short of these benchmarks typically have identifiable gaps in claim submission, denial management, or patient balance collection that can be addressed systematically.

How much 90-day dental AR is actually collectible?

Only 15-25% of dental AR over 90 days is typically collectible, according to IC System and Southwest Recovery Services. The probability drops further past 120 days, with accounts at that age worth approximately 33 cents on the dollar. This is why early intervention before claims cross the 60-day mark has a disproportionate impact on total AR recovery.

What is the timely-filing window for dental claims?

Most dental insurance payers set timely-filing windows of 90-365 days from the date of service after which claims cannot be submitted or resubmitted regardless of their merit. This makes response speed to denials critical: a claim denied at day 60 that is not resubmitted within 30 days may fall outside the timely-filing window permanently, converting a recoverable claim into a write-off.
